Transaction 90693282d4ecefcd4147c774ef64e671e3fd685f4c83404154450f4da2bf4503
1 Input
1 Output
-
90693282d4ecefcd4147c774ef64e671e3fd685f4c83404154450f4da2bf4503:0
- value
- 6593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02d1534878f2b455f483ef0aa56dc14db250abfb OP_EQUAL
- address
- 31wv376eaUMk1EpCHXPpKGkreZCZ8KoS6m